When the outside world was still dizzy with the concept of the metaverse, yet another new word related to the metaverse swept the entire industry.

A few days ago, Microsoft announced that Kawasaki Heavy Industries has become a new customer of its "Industrial Metaverse" business. Kawasaki Heavy Industries plans to let shop floor workers wear Microsoft HoloLens headsets to assist in production, maintenance and supply chain management. Microsoft's industrial metaverse already has two important customers, Heinz and Boeing.

In addition to Microsoft's entry into the "Industrial Metaverse", another technology giant, Nvidia, is also targeting the "Industrial Metaverse". Based on the Omniverse platform, AI and computing technologies, Nvidia can achieve the results of building an industrial Metaverse.

Peek into the "Industrial Metaverse"

The Metaverse emerged in two contexts. On the one hand, it exists in the digitization of offline scenes, mainly in the fields of social and consumer Internet, such as the "Social Metaverse", "Game Metaverse", and "Sports Metaverse". ” and so on; on the other hand, the demand for digital transformation stemming from industry and industry, that is, the industrial metaverse.

The simplest understanding of the "industrial metaverse" is the application of concepts and technologies related to the metaverse in the industrial field.

Similar to the metaverse, the industrial metaverse is not a technology, but a collection of technical concepts. It is also based on the Internet and is a product of the highly developed digital information.

A definition that is often mentioned in the industry: the industrial metaverse is a new industrial ecology that is deeply integrated with new information and communication technologies represented by XR and digital twins and the real industrial economy. Through technologies such as XR, AI, loT, cloud computing, and digital twins, we will open up seamless connections between people, machines, objects, and systems, realize the combination of digital technology and real industries, and promote the efficient development of physical industries.

If the metaverse is regarded as a world where virtual reality, reality, and people, ideas, and consciousness are combined, then the industrial metaverse is a part of the metaverse. If the metaverse is regarded as a concept and a technology, then the industrial metaverse can be understood as the application of the metaverse concept and technology in industry, which is the qualitative change factor for the metaverse to empower industry and promote industrial improvement, innovation, and even revolution .

For example, the Industrial Metaverse may take digital twins to a whole new level. Simulation testing in the metaverse environment allows industrial companies to test thousands of potential scenarios for their own ecosystems and choose the best strategy for their production. Through such methods and predictions, enterprises can not only understand the operation of equipment in real time, but also predict the future use results of production equipment.

And production-level simulation is just the beginning of a series of potential industrial-level applications. In a report previously published by Industry Week, IDC analyst Jan Burian provided some compelling use cases that the industrial metaverse will realize: through virtual factories Visiting and interactive assembly enhance brand awareness, use digital humans to simulate human behavior, and realize the layout, performance, and interaction simulation of machines, factories, supply chains, and even the entire ecosystem, all of which can be realized through related technologies and applications of the industrial metaverse.

The only way for the "industrial metaverse" is the digital twin platform, or digital twin, which is a state presented by the development of the industrial metaverse.

Digital twin is a 1:1 mapping from the real world to the virtual world. It simulates the industrial production in the real world by controlling the production process and production equipment in the virtual world, and pays more attention to "from virtual to real".

The virtual world reflected in the industrial metaverse not only has a mapping of the real world, but also has experiences and interactions that have not yet been realized or even cannot be realized in the real world. It is a transformation from "virtual to real" to "virtual and real collaboration".

At present, the application of digital twins in pan-industry is becoming more and more popular. For example, in the port scene, driven by dynamic data in real time, in the digital twin all-element scene, it can cover the full-cycle operation simulation from cargo arrival, loading and unloading, stacking, warehousing and port departure.

In areas that are closer to our daily life, such as subways and communities, digital twin related technologies have also been applied. Previously, 51WORLD cooperated with iFLYTEK to create a smart community platform for Pingping Street Community in Guancheng District, Zhengzhou. It fully empowered security, service, environment, etc., and provided community managers with three-dimensional visualization and intuitive management methods, forming a Efficient management mode.

At present, many domestic enterprises are moving closer to intelligent manufacturing. As a mobile phone industry that relies heavily on fully automated production lines, it can be said to be one of the typical ones.

At present, the first phase of Xiaomi Smart Factory has been offline for production, and the second phase of the factory is expected to start production by the end of 2023. The Xiaomi smart factory is a highly intelligent "black light factory". It can realize full-automatic unmanned production inside, and only manual material supply. It is truly automated, informatized, and intelligent, with an annual output of one million units.

In addition, automobile manufacturing also requires a highly automated intelligent production line. Domestic automaker Geely Automobile has extensively used cyber physics systems in new car design, process development, and trial production verification, which has greatly shortened the development cycle of new cars; among foreign automakers, BMW is also cooperating with Nvidia on virtual factories. BMW will introduce the Nvidia Omniverse platform to coordinate the production of 31 factories, which is expected to increase BMW's production efficiency by 30%.
